Eula Mae Holland 1900–1963 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 11 April 1900
Birth Location: Reliance, Brazos County, Texas, United States of America
Death Date: 9 May 1963
Death Location: College Station, Brazos County, Texas, United States of America
Father: Jacob Holland
Mother: Mary Caldwell

The story of Eula Mae Holland began in 1900 in Reliance, Brazos County, Texas, United States of America. In 1900, Eula Mae Holland resided in Justice Precinct 3, Brazos, Texas, USA. Eula Mae Holland passed away in 1963 in College Station, Brazos County, Texas, United States of America.
